QUESTION NO: 1
According to Article.33 of the GDPR the controller shall without undue delay and, where feasible, not later than 72 hours after having become aware of it, notify the personal data breach to the supervisory authority. What is the maximum penalty for non-compliance with this notification obligation?
A. Up to € 500.000 with a minimum of € 120.000
B. € 10.000.000 or 2% of the annual global turnover, whichever is higher
C. Up to € 820.000 with a minimum of € 350.000
D. € 20.000.000 or 4% of the annual global turnover, whichever is higher
Answer: B
Explanation:
€ 10.000.000 or 2% of the annual global turnover, whichever is higher. Correct. This is the maximum according to the GDPR for infringement of the personal data breach notification obligation. (Literature: A, Chapter 7; GDPR Article 33)
€ 20.000.000 or 4% of the annual global turnover, whichever is higher. Incorrect. This fine is given for non- compliance or non-conformity to the basic principles for processing, including conditions for consent.
Up to € 500.000 with a minimum of € 120.000. Incorrect. This is an outdated number based on the Dutch Penal code. GDPR rules specify higher fines.
Up to € 820.000 with a minimum of € 350.000. Incorrect. This is an outdated number based on the Dutch Penal code. GDPR rules specify higher fines.

QUESTION NO: 3
A company wishes to use personal data of their customers. They wish to start sending all female customers a customized newsletter. What right do all data subjects have in this scenario?
A. The right to rectification
B. The right to object to profiling
C. The right to compensation
Answer: B
Explanation:
The right to compensation. Incorrect. It is unlikely that all data subjects will suffer harm that must be compensated in this scenario.
The right to object to profiling. Correct. All data subjects have a right to object to the processing of personal data for direct marketing, including profiling. This is clearly profiling.
(Literature: A, Chapter 4) The right to rectification. Incorrect. It is unlikely that the company has incorrect data on all data subjects, so the right to rectification does not apply.

QUESTION NO: 4
Which condition below allows personal data to be processed legally?
A. There must be a legitimate basis for data processing.
B. Holders' rights must be protected by a privacy policy.
C. A Data Privacy Impact Assessment (DPIA) should be performed prior to data collection.
D. Data processing must be previously authorized by the Supervisory Authority.
Answer: A
Explanation:
Article 6 legislates on the lawfulness of treatment and in it cites the 6 legal bases provided:
1 - the data subject has given consent to the processing of his or her personal data for one or more specific purposes;
2- processing is necessary for the performance of a contract to which the data subject is party or in order to take steps at the request of the data subject prior to entering a contract
3 - processing is necessary for compliance with a legal obligation to which the controller is subject;
4- processing is necessary in order to protect the vital interests of the data subject or of another natural person;
5 - processing is necessary for the performance of a task carried out in the public interest or in the exercise of official authority vested in the controller;
6 - processing is necessary for the purposes of the legitimate interests pursued by the controller or by a third party, except where such interests are overridden by the interests or fundamental rights and freedoms of the data subject which requires protection of personal data, in particular where the data subject is a child.

QUESTION NO: 5
What year did the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) come into force?
A. 2017
B. 2016
C. 2018
D. 2019
Answer: C
Explanation:
The deadline for companies to adapt and comply with GDPR was May 25, 2018. This is an important date and should be memorized. It is common to have this question in this exam.
Article 99 of GDPR
1. This Regulation shall enter into force on the twentieth day following that of its publication in the Official Journal of the European Union.
2. It shall apply from 25 May 2018.
